How to Choose the Right Entertainment Options
Selecting the right content in the seemingly infinite stream of options starts with understanding your personal interests and setting clear intentions. Begin by asking yourself what you seek from your entertainment experiences. Are you looking to relax, learn something new, or perhaps escape into a different world? Knowing the purpose can dramatically narrow down the choices and reduce the overwhelming feeling of the digital bazaar.
Additionally, adopting a more minimalist approach to digital content consumption can be beneficial. Limit your subscriptions to one or two major streaming services that best match your preferences and consistently deliver content you enjoy. Quality over quantity can lead to a more satisfying and less stressful viewing experience.
It’s also helpful to set specific times for entertainment, much like scheduling portions of your day for work or fitness. This can prevent the common pitfall of mindless scrolling and help make your engagement with digital content more intentional and fulfilling.
Understanding Maintenance and Ownership Costs
In the context of digital entertainment, 'maintenance' involves managing your subscriptions and being aware of the mental and emotional investment they require. It's important to regularly review your subscription services to ensure they are still worth both the financial cost and your time. Consider the following:
- Subscription Fatigue: Monitor your subscription usage. If a service isn’t being used often enough to justify the cost, it might be time to cancel.
- Emotional Cost: Be conscious of how content affects your emotional wellbeing. If certain genres or platforms tend to leave you feeling drained or anxious, consider reducing your exposure to them.
- Time Investment: Entertainment should not feel like a job. If keeping up with certain shows or platforms feels obligatory, it might be a sign to rethink how you spend your leisure time.
